How can I find a dermatologist in Saint Johns, Florida, and what should I look for in a local practice?

You can find dermatologists in Saint Johns by searching online directories, checking with your primary care physician for referrals, or contacting local healthcare networks like Flagler Health+. Look for practices with board-certified dermatologists who have experience treating common Florida skin issues like sun damage and skin cancer, and consider their office location and patient reviews for convenience and quality of care.

What are the most common dermatology services offered by practices in Saint Johns, FL?

Dermatology practices in Saint Johns typically offer skin cancer screenings, acne treatment, mole removal, and management of sun-related conditions like actinic keratosis. Many also provide cosmetic services such as Botox, fillers, and laser treatments for sun spots or wrinkles, which are popular in this sunny climate. It's best to contact individual clinics for a full list of their specialized services.

What insurance and payment options are generally accepted by dermatologists in Saint Johns?

Most dermatology offices in Saint Johns accept major insurance plans like Medicare, Blue Cross Blue Shield, Aetna, and Cigna, but it's important to verify coverage directly with the practice before your appointment. For those without insurance or with high deductibles, many clinics offer self-pay discounts, payment plans, or accept credit cards and HSA/FSA payments to make care more accessible.

How long is the typical wait time for a new patient dermatology appointment in Saint Johns, Florida?

Wait times for new patient appointments in Saint Johns can vary, but generally range from a few weeks to a couple of months, depending on the practice and the urgency of your condition. For routine checks, you may wait longer, but many offices prioritize urgent issues like suspicious moles or rashes, so be sure to describe your symptoms clearly when scheduling.

Are there dermatologists in Saint Johns who specialize in skin cancer detection and treatment, given Florida's high sun exposure?

Yes, many dermatologists in Saint Johns specialize in skin cancer detection, treatment, and prevention, utilizing tools like full-body skin exams and dermatoscopy. Given Florida's high UV index, local practices are well-versed in managing melanoma, basal cell carcinoma, and squamous cell carcinoma, and often emphasize regular screenings and sun protection education for their patients.

Your Guide to a Dermatologist Consultation in Saint Johns, FL

Living in Saint Johns, Florida, means enjoying beautiful weather year-round, but our sunny climate and active lifestyles also present unique challenges for our skin. From intense UV exposure to humidity that can exacerbate certain conditions, knowing when and why to seek a dermatologist consultation is key to maintaining healthy skin. A consultation is more than just a quick check-up; it’s a personalized assessment and the first step toward effective, long-term skin health tailored to your life here in Northeast Florida.

Many people delay scheduling a dermatologist consultation, thinking it’s only necessary for a severe problem. However, a proactive consultation is one of the smartest things you can do for your skin. It’s an opportunity to establish a baseline with a skin care expert, discuss preventive strategies against sun damage—a critical concern in our Florida sun—and address any subtle changes you’ve noticed. Whether it’s a mole that looks different, persistent dryness, or early signs of aging you’d like to manage, a consultation provides clarity and a clear path forward.

Preparing for your consultation will help you get the most out of the visit. Before your appointment, take note of any specific concerns, such as new growths, itchy patches, or acne flare-ups. Make a list of all skincare products and medications you currently use, including over-the-counter items. It’s also helpful to jot down your family history of skin conditions, like melanoma or psoriasis. During the consultation, your dermatologist will likely perform a thorough skin exam and discuss your daily routine, sun exposure habits, and lifestyle factors common in Saint Johns, such as time spent on the golf course, boating on the St. Johns River, or enjoying our many outdoor parks.

Finding the right dermatologist in the Saint Johns area is crucial. Look for a board-certified professional who understands the local environmental factors. A local dermatologist will be well-versed in treating conditions prevalent in our humid climate, like fungal infections or heat rash, and can offer practical advice on sun protection that fits an active Florida lifestyle. They can also provide guidance on managing conditions like rosacea, which can be triggered by sun and heat.
